What is your typical process for working with a new customer?

unfold fold
We begin with a consultation to ensure we are a good fit. That appointment is on us with no charges. You get to explain who you are, what you do and the challenges you are facing. We get to explain our process, what we are best at, and if we are in alignment with your goals. If we decide that we are a good fit, we submit a proposal for our approval that outlines what we will do with associated costs. Then we move forward as a team to execute your exceptional results!
